> Users would like easy inline caching
> This is the epic for the inline caching improvements -- write behind, write through, read through.
> The goal is here to allow users easy mapping of region to table.  Either the user can provide a simple field to column config file and it is injected at runtime (more flexible) or we use a simple name to name mapping with no configuration needed.  
> Feedback 1: "people don't like the idea of every team writing the same kind of write behind logic again and again"
> Feedback 2: "I write a lot of boiler plate code over and over again for this very thing"
